X-Ray Crystallographic Analysis of Methyl(1S,2R,5R,6S,7R)-5,6-Dimethyl-2(.OMEGA.-camphanoyloxy)bicyclo(4.3.0)nonane-7-carboxylate. Revision of the Absolute Configurations of the Liverwort Sesquiterpenoids(-)-Chiloscyphone and(+)-Chiloscypholone.

The X-ray analysis of the title compound has been carried out to give unambiguous assignment of the absolute configurations of the liverwort sesquiterpenoids (−)-chiloscyphone and (+)-chiloscypholone, each for which the enantiomerically opposite configurations had been assigned in the previous report.
